INVISIBLE LIBRARY EXHBITION

13th JUNE - 12th JULY [2009—closed]

---------------------------------

Illustration collective INK and Literary foundation Real Fits take residency at the Tenderpixel Gallery for a month of unique events, construction of a hidden library filled with books that have been alluded to in novels by published writers but have never actually existed... until now. Once selected and written, the hidden novels will have their covers illustrated by INK. The Invisible Library will ask best selling writers Iain Sinclair and Saci Lloyd, cultural and musical figures, to be announced, and gallery attendees to write the opening or closing page of a 'hidden novel.'
